What you will be responsible for:

We are seeking a dedicated and highly organized Material Handler to join our residential construction team. The Material Handler will be responsible for safely and efficiently distributing materials and tools between construction sites. This role requires attention to detail, strong physical stamina, and the ability to work collaboratively with other team members to ensure the smooth flow of materials and tools required for our onsite projects.

Duties and Responsibilities:

  • Transport tools and materials from Site Ops centralized inventory to the designated job sites throughout the Southern Bay Area, as requested by the Materials Manager and Project Coordinator. Ensure timely delivery to avoid delays in construction schedules.
  • With Materials Manager, Project Coordinator, and Site Team, coordinate and execute material and tool returns from construction sites to Site Ops centralized inventory to ensure that unnecessary items are removed from sites.
  • Receive, store, and organize construction tools & materials in Site Ops centralized inventory. Ensure materials are properly marked, tracked, and stored to prevent damage or loss.
  • Maintain accurate inventory records. Perform regular checks and audits to ensure materials are accounted for and that there is no shortage or excess. Report discrepancies to Construction Materials Manager.
  • Safely load and unload materials from trucks and storage areas. Operate material handling equipment, such as dolleys or pallet jacks, to move heavy materials to and from the storage locations or construction site as needed.
  • Work closely with Materials Manager, Project Coordinator, Superintendents and Foremen to ensure tools and materials are available when needed and construction timelines are met.
  • Inspect and maintain material handling equipment, ensuring all tools and machinery are in safe working condition. Report any mechanical issues promptly.
  • Follow all safety protocols and guidelines for handling materials, tools, and equipment. Report any unsafe conditions or accidents to the supervisor immediately.

Minimum Qualifications and Skills:

  • Previous experience as a Material Handler, Warehouse Worker, or in a similar role, preferably in the construction industry.
  • Applicants must own a reliable truck suitable for transporting materials/equipment as part of the job requirements.
  • Ability to lift and carry heavy materials on a regular basis.
  • Comfortable working in outdoor environments and in various weather conditions.
  • Ability to safely operate pallet jacks or other material handling equipment.
  • Basic math skills to assist with inventory control and material management.
  • Excellent communication and problem-solving skills.
  • Strong attention to detail and a commitment to speed, quality and safety.
  • Hunger to be part of a team interested in being the best.
  • Strong internal drive & motivation, Bias for Action, and growth mindset.
  • Ability to respectfully voice opinions, gracefully receive feedback, and collaboratively analyze and resolve problems.
  • Must be comfortable working in a fast-paced, physically demanding construction environment.

Preferred Qualifications:

  • Familiar with standard concepts, practices, and procedures within the US construction field.
  • Familiarity with modular construction processes is a plus.
  • Forklift certification or other relevant material handling certifications.
  • OSHA certification for construction safety is a plus.
